Your Committee on Culture & the Arts, to which was referred S.B. No. 2399, S.D. 2, entitled:
"A BILL FOR AN ACT RELATING TO URBAN ART,"
begs leave to report as follows:
Your Committee notes concerns raised about the maintenance of urban art after its creation on state-owned buildings and the problems that could arise from not maintaining the integrity of this urban artwork.
Your Committee has amended this measure by:
(1) Giving the State Foundation on Culture and the Arts the sole discretion to establish procedures for the pilot program to more narrowly regulate urban art on state-owned property;
(2) Requiring the State Foundation on Culture and the Arts to establish procedures that designate specific areas for urban art on state-owned property;
(3) Adding the Historic Hawaii Foundation, in addition to the Historic Preservation Division of the Department of Land and Natural Resources, for consultation to ensure that urban art does not cause an adverse effect to historic property;
(4) Specifically excluding graffiti from being considered urban art;
(5) Requiring the State Foundation on Culture and the Arts' report to the Legislature on the status of the pilot program to include necessary proposed legislation and recommendations to reduce illicit graffiti;
(6) Changing the effective date to upon its approval; and
(7) Making technical, nonsubstantive amendments for clarity, consistency, and style.
As affirmed by the record of votes of the members of your Committee on Culture & the Arts that is attached to this report, your Committee is in accord with the intent and purpose of S.B. No. 2399, S.D. 2, as amended herein, and recommends that it pass Second Reading in the form attached hereto as S.B. No. 2399, S.D. 2, H.D. 1, and be referred to the Committee on Finance.
